What Is Alphatest?
Alphatest refers to internal testing conducted by developers, quality assurance teams, or company staff. Unlike beta testing, which involves real users, Alphatest is performed in a controlled environment. The goal is not to perfect the product but to ensure that the core features work as intended. During this stage, testers focus on basic functionality, system stability, usability flow, and major error detection. Alphatest allows teams to confirm that the product is ready to move forward without serious technical risks.

Key Features Tested During Alphatest
During Alphatest, teams focus on several important areas. Functionality testing checks whether features operate according to specifications. Performance testing evaluates response time and system stability. Security testing identifies vulnerabilities that could expose sensitive data. Usability testing ensures navigation and layout are understandable. Compatibility testing checks how the product behaves across devices, browsers, or operating systems. Together, these checks help create a reliable and stable product base.

Alphatest vs Beta Test
Although often confused, Alphatest and beta testing serve different purposes. Alphatest is internal and conducted by the development team, while beta testing involves external users. Alphatest focuses on functionality and technical stability, whereas beta testing focuses on real-world user experience and feedback. Alphatest occurs earlier in the development cycle, while beta testing happens closer to final release. Both stages are essential, but Alphatest lays the groundwork for successful beta testing.
Common Challenges in Alphatest
Despite its benefits, Alphatest can face challenges. Limited testing environments may not fully reflect real-world usage. Internal testers may overlook usability issues because they are familiar with the product. Time pressure can also limit test coverage. To overcome these challenges, teams should use detailed test cases, automated testing tools, and structured reporting methods. A well-planned Alphatest strategy increases accuracy and efficiency.
Best Practices for Effective Alphatest
To maximize results, Alphatest should follow best practices. Clear testing objectives must be defined before starting. Test cases should cover both expected and unexpected scenarios. Documentation of bugs should be detailed and organized. Communication between developers and testers must remain consistent. Re-testing after fixes is equally important to ensure problems do not reappear. These practices help maintain quality throughout development.
